Ephesians 4
20 Ref For this was not the teaching of Christ which was given to you;
21 Ref If in fact you gave ear to him, and were given teaching in him, even as what is true is made clear in Jesus:
22 Ref That you are to put away, in relation to your earlier way of life, the old man, which has become evil by love of deceit;
23 Ref And be made new in the spirit of your mind,
24 Ref And put on the new man, to which God has given life, in righteousness and a true and holy way of living.
25 Ref And so, putting away false words, let everyone say what is true to his neighbour: for we are parts one of another.
26 Ref Be angry without doing wrong; let not the sun go down on your wrath;
27 Ref And do not give way to the Evil One.
28 Ref Let him who was a thief be so no longer, but let him do good work with his hands, so that he may have something to give to him who is in need.
29 Ref Let no evil talk come out of your mouth, but only what is good for giving necessary teaching, and for grace to those who give ear.
30 Ref And do not give grief to the Holy Spirit of God, by whom you were marked for the day of salvation.
31 Ref Let all bitter, sharp and angry feeling, and noise, and evil words, be put away from you, with all unkind acts;
32 Ref And be kind to one another, full of pity, having forgiveness for one another, even as God in Christ had forgiveness for you.
